NATIONAL ANTI-HIJACKING POLICE NPO

 

Established in 2020 by Marius Cloete, was an entity named Anti-Hijacking & Policing SA. The goal of this was to be of assistance to the public free of charge to contribute to fighting crime in the community.

As a former member of the South African Police Service, that served from 1995 to 2013 in a specialized rapid reaction unit that dealt with crime, murder, and robbery, he obtained a lifetime of experience in crime combating in South Africa.

 

In 2020 Marius Cloete realized the need for an independent unit that can assist Law Enforcement with crime combating and assist with crime scene management to ensure that individuals don’t disturb any evidence that can be useful and lead to positive arrests.

 

The decision then was made to register a legal entity to contribute to the safety of the public by combating all levels of crime in Gauteng and Mpumalanga, at this stage we were still a PTY LTD entity registered with CIPC.

 

He faced many challenges financially since the work they do and the service to the public is FREE of charge and all the expenses came out of our own pockets like fuel, vehicle maintenance, equipment, uniforms, and so forth.

 

In 2024 the call was made to register an NPO which was done under the name, NATIONAL ANTI – HIJACKING POLICE (NPO)

Now as  NPO, NATIONAL ANTI–HIJACKING POLICE  will strive for new heights as an organization and will go nationwide in the next five years.

 

Our Role in Public Safety:

 

Ninety percent of the work that we do, we do in conjunction with the South African Police Service and other Law Enforcement Agencies. We use specialized units witch members are handpicked to ensure that there are no corruption and bribery involved when arrests get made. This is one of the reasons why we have a big success rate when it comes to crime combating.

 

Our most important goal is to assist and protect the public against violent criminal elements and to put the safety of the public first, other than security companies that use and misuse the combating of crime to enrich themselves financially. We have a handful of dedicated members who offer their own free time to help us make a difference in the combating of crime and to contribute to making South Africa a safer place for us, the community, and the children.

 

We practice zero tolerance to any form of crime, and we make sure that the perpetrators pay the ultimate price in the court of law. We have assisted the police in many high-profile cases, like the Michael Jacobus Willemans case, he was wanted for more than two years and six months, we worked alongside Welkom detectives for the whole above period and then finally we made the arrest. Our Goal:

We want to take serious action against the following crimes that are taking place daily:

 

  • Business Robberies / Armed Robberies
  • Hijackings
  • Human Trafficking
  • Gender-Based Violence (GBV)
  • Spiking’s
  • Drug dealings that occur in business complexes
  • Theft of motor vehicles in business complexes
  • General Drug Trafficking (to keep the children safe from such negative exposure)

To try and prevent the events of CIT robberies in this town or to foil the event, because these robbers are ruthless and don’t care about human life, who dies or gets seriously injured during such an event.
